A
RESOLUTION
Honoring
the life of Johnny Robinson and expressing regret at his passing; and for other
purposes.
WHEREAS,
Johnny Robinson was a native of College Park, Georgia, who loved his community
and its citizens and dedicated himself to serving their needs; and
WHEREAS,
Mr. Robinson served on the College Park City Council from 1988 to 1992 and again
from 1994 to 2002; and
WHEREAS,
Mr. Robinson decided to run for College
Parḱs
City Council to make sure the area where he had grown up would remain a good
place to call home; and
WHEREAS,
during his 12 years in office, he worked to revitalize the
citýs
downtown district, preserve its residential character, and protect its citizens
from encroachment by Hartsfield-Jackson International Airport; and
WHEREAS,
a former elementary school teacher, he also served as a member of a number of
boards and organizations, including the College Park NAACP, the South Fulton
Municipal Association, the Georgia Municipal Association, the Georgia
Association of Black Elected Officials, and the National Black Caucus of Local
Elected Officials; and
WHEREAS,
Mr. Robinson cared deeply about his community and was always sincere in his
efforts to help and he will be sincerely missed.
